Wave |
A disturbance that carries energy from one location to another. |
|
Medium |
The material the disturbance travels through |
|
Propagation |
The movement of the distrurbance |
|
Longitudinal Wave |
A wave in which the particles of the medium move in a direction parallel to the direction of propagation. |
|
Transverse wave |
A wave in which the particles of the medium move in a direction perpendicular to the propagation |
|
Wavelength |
Distance between one crest and the next crest represented by lambda. |
|
Period |
The time it takes a wavelength to pass a single point represented by T |
|
Frequency |
The number of complete wavelengths that pass a single point in 1 second represented by f |
